None City of Manstee Planning Commission Meeting Minutes of November 1, 2018 Page 1 NEW BUSINESS County Staff Introductions Mr. Carson introduced Tamara Buswinka, contracting City Zoning Administrator and Nancy Baker, County Planning Assistant and City Historic and City Planning Commission Secretary. OLD BUSINESS Tracey Lindeman Permit Extension Request PZ17-020 A permit extension was requested due to the inability to perform the work until 2019. The Manistee City Historic District Commission granted a 9-month extension (July 2019) as of November 1, 2018 in which time the project is to be completed. Motion by Michael Szymanski, seconded by Roger Yoder to grant the 9-month extension to allow for completion of the project. With a Roll Call vote this motion passed 6 to 0. Yes: Szymanski, Slawinski, Berry, McBride, Yoder and Wittlieff No: None PC Members and Terms The Planning Commission presented the PC Members and Terms with Wittlief, McBride and Slawinski terms expiring October 31, 2019, Szymanski, Barry and Yoder expiring October 31, 2020 and Thomas expiring October 31, 2021. PC Meeting Dates and Times The Planning Commission presented the approved 2019 Meeting dates and times. Joe Hayes, 12th Street Road Improvement Project Update Special Use Permits A construction meeting will take place regarding the plans of 3rd stage building not occurring until mining is complete. A soil erosion compliance site visit will be done by the county. PUBLIC Comments and Communications None CORRESPONDENCE None STAFF REPORTS Tamara Buswinka, City Zoning Administrator The city zoning administrator communicated that some applications have not been properly completed, resulting in delays of their permits. Discussion on the zoning procedures and future ways to prevent these delays ensued. Rob Carson, Manistee County Planning Director The city received a 1-year grant for becoming a Rise and Tide Community. Interviews for the Rise and Tide fellowship position are in the process.
